Taxonomic Information
Siccia Walker, 1854 species known from India.
Siccia albisparsa (Hampson, 1898). India: NE India, Meghalaya (TL: Khasi Hills).
Siccia amnaea (Swinhoe, 1894). India: NE India, Meghalaya, Arunachal Pradesh.
Siccia flavescens Hampson, 1898. India: Meghalaya (TL: Khasi Hills).
Siccia fulvocincta (Hampson, 1900). India: S. India (TL: Nilgiris).
Siccia maculifascia (Moore, 1878). India: NE India, Arunachal Pradesh, West Bengal.
Siccia guttulosana (Walker, 1863). India; North India, Tamil Nadu, Maharashtra, Kerala, Andhra Pradesh, West Bengal; Sri Lanka.
Siccia mesozonata Hampson, 1898. India: NE India, Meghalaya, Arunachal Pradesh.
Siccia minima (Hampson, 1900). India: West Bengla; Sri Lanka (TL).
Siccia nilgirica (Hampson, 1891). India: S India; Sri Lanka.
Siccia nocturna (Hampson, 1900). India: India: Meghalaya (TL: Khasi Hills).
Siccia quinquefascia (Hampson, 1891). India: S. India, Tamil Nadu (TL: Nilgiris).
Siccia sagittifera (Moore, 1888). India: Himachal Pradesh (TL: Dharmsala), Uttarakhand, Jammu & Kashmir, West Bengal.
Siccia seriata Hampson, 1900. India: NE India, Thailand.
Siccia sordida (Butler, 1877). India: Coimbatore (TL), Punjab, Himachal Pradesh.; Sri Lanka. Aemene subcinerea Moore, 1878 is a synonym.
Siccia spotoptera (N. Singh & Kirti, 2016). India: Kerala.
Siccia taprobanis (Walker, 1854). India; Sri Lanka; Nepal; W and SW China.
Siccia tenebrosa (Moore, 1878). India: Maharashtra (TL: Mumbai), Madhya Pradesh.
Note: As per Volynkin et al (2023), the genus Aemene Walker, 1854 stands revised to Siccia Walker, 1854.
